Observation details
Continuing, viewed with many other birders. Bird was posted up in a scraggly tree in the NW corner of the smaller, eastern pond of the beef research area. Viewing distance was 200-300 yards. It would occasionally fly out and (assumedly) make attempts at catching rodents in the field, but would always return to the same tree. Front of bird was decidedly white overall; no belly band or prominent streaking present. Undersides of wings were predominately white as well, with black tipping seen on ends of primary and primary covert feathers. The head of the bird appeared a pale grey and had a dark eye bar. Both the basal area of its beak and its feet were a noticeable yellow (the former detail requiring a scope to see.)
